Subject: [Bug 221774] hid-multitouch: report ID mismatch check breaks touchpad palm detection on ASUS ROG Flow Z13 (2025) GZ302EA (0b05:1a30)

--- Comment #2 from Lovekesh Solanki (lovekeshsolanki00@gmail.com) ---
It is possible the commit e716edafedad causes mt_get_feature() to reject the
Win8 response due to firmware returning mismatched report Id. So
hid_report_raw_event() is never reached and device doesn't switch into
Precision mode.
Rather than reverting the commit, which would drop the ID check for every
device, it may be possible to add a quirk for 0b05:1a30 so only this model
tolerates the mismatch.

I have prepared a patch which does that, but I don't have the hardware so I
cannot confirm.
